Runbook: CrashFunnel pipeline stalled. Check ingest lag first. If lag > 10m, restart the symbolication workers. If workers crash-loop, the env file on the ingest host is likely stale — this happens after every Parqview image rebuild. Fix: regenerate the env file from the template, confirm queue URL and region, redeploy. Do not copy the old file; credentials rotate on rebuild. Fetch the fresh credential from the vault tool, then append the line that authorizes ingest uploads to the report store:

vault entry, bagep-yahip: VAULT_KEY8=d2a227e5

**Q: Why did search results go stale overnight?**

A: The nightly Quillstack reindex job failed silently again. It runs at 02:00 and rebuilds the full index; if it dies, results lag a day. Fix lands next sprint. Until then, rerun manually after failures. The rerun procedure is documented on this page:

runbook for badug-kadup: https://confluence.zemvarlabs.internal/projects/browse/display/projects/bd1b

## Changed defaults — v4.2.0

The Pellwick GraphQL layer now batches resolver lookups by default, eliminating the N+1 pattern that caused last month's database saturation. Dataloader batching is enabled for all list fields, and the per-request cache is on unless explicitly disabled. On-call: watch batch-size metrics for the first 48 hours. The new defaults ship as the following configuration.

config for haweg-bagag:
[kasath]
host = kasath.qirvancorp.internal
user = kasath_svc
database = kasath_prod